Amid Opposition Din, Odisha Govt Presents Rs 19833 Cr Supplementary Budget 
Amid Opposition Din, Odisha Govt Presents Rs 19833 Cr Supplementary Budget 

The highest provision of Rs 3624 crore has been made for the Panchayati Raj and drinking water department, Rs 2310 crore for Health and Family Welfare department and Rs 2143 crore for Energy department.

Draft of Supplementary Budget gets State Cabinet nod

The State council of ministers on Saturday approved the draft proposal of the first Supplementary Budget for the 2013-14 financial year. The meeting was held under the chairmanship of chief minister Naveen Patnaik at the State Secretariat here
